Mining Bitcoin 2020: A Brief Overview
Bitcoin mining is the process by which new bitcoins are entered into circulation and is also a critical component of the maintenance and development of the blockchain ledger. Miners use powerful computers to solve complex mathematical puzzles, and when they find a solution, they are rewarded with bitcoins. This process ensures the security and integrity of the Bitcoin network.
The mining process has become increasingly competitive over the years, with more miners joining the network and the difficulty of the puzzles increasing. In 2020, the mining landscape has witnessed several changes that have impacted the profitability and sustainability of mining operations.
Challenges Faced by Miners in 2020
1. High Energy Costs: One of the most significant challenges faced by miners in 2020 is the soaring energy costs. As the difficulty of mining puzzles increases, so does the energy consumption, making it essential for miners to find cost-effective energy sources.
2. Regulatory Hurdles: Governments around the world are increasingly scrutinizing the cryptocurrency industry, and mining operations are not immune to this trend. In some countries, mining activities have been banned or heavily regulated, making it difficult for miners to operate legally.
3. Hardware Costs: The cost of mining equipment has been on the rise, with the latest generation of ASIC (Application-Specific Integrated Circuit) miners being more expensive and power-hungry than their predecessors. This has made it challenging for new entrants to enter the mining space.
4. Market Volatility: The price of Bitcoin has been highly volatile in recent years, which directly impacts the profitability of mining operations. When Bitcoin prices are low, mining becomes less profitable, and some miners may be forced to shut down their operations.
